/**
* @class EventableObject
* EventableObject means that the class inheriting this is able to take
* events. This 'base' class will store and update these events upon
* receiving the call from the instance thread / WorldRunnable thread.
*/

/**
* @class EventableObjectHolder
* EventableObjectHolder will store eventable objects, and remove/add them when they change
* from one holder to another (changing maps / instances).
*
* EventableObjectHolder also updates all the timed events in all of its objects when its
* update function is called.
*
*/
